Weld County Hopes YouTube Video Can Catch Burglars

GREELEY, Colo. (CBS4) ― Investigators in Weld County have turned to YouTube in hopes of catching criminals. The latest Internet video from the sheriff's department shows a home burglary where deputies are looking for the thieves.

The video was taken by a home security system. It shows the burglars approaching the home in the middle of the day.

They smash a window to get inside.

A woman stands guard while a man searches the house for valuables.

"The images that we're hoping people recognize is maybe the way the person walked," said Shane Scofield, a Weld County sheriff's deputy. "The fact that they smoke, maybe the new girlfriend, maybe if it is a new girlfriend, a co-worker, clothing descriptions."

Investigators said the pair has burglarized at least four homes since late March.
